Transaction 7d024363579daae44de7d6d45abc7f6bc40c15654bb6c8ff04e72bbeb001226d

1 Input
1 Outputs
  • 7d024363579daae44de7d6d45abc7f6bc40c15654bb6c8ff04e72bbeb001226d:0
  • value  599156
    address  38fxursteHTVqTZ5FGBoR339VPrDo8mjzA